What an AI-Powered Side Hustle Really Means

An AI-powered side hustle is simply a small business or income stream where you use AI tools to work faster, think clearer, and create more value. You are not replacing your talent. You are amplifying it.

For example, if you are good at fitness, AI can help you create meal plans, workout guides, and social media posts. If you are good at teaching, AI can help you turn your knowledge into worksheets, mini-courses, and ebooks. If you are good at writing, AI can help you brainstorm, edit, and format content for clients or buyers.

Step 1: Identify Skills You Already Use

Start by making a list of things you do naturally, at work, at home, or for friends and family. Don’t overthink it. Look for skills that come easily to you or that people already ask you for help with.

  • Writing emails, posts, captions, or reports
  • Explaining things in a simple way
  • Creating schedules or organizing tasks
  • Designing graphics or presentations
  • Cooking, planning meals, or creating routines
  • Helping people solve technical or practical problems
  • Coaching, encouraging, or motivating others
  • Selling, networking, or persuading

If someone would say, “You’re really good at that,” write it down. That is often the beginning of a side hustle.

Step 2: Match the Skill to a Problem

A side hustle becomes profitable when it solves a real problem. Instead of asking, “What can I sell?” ask, “What problem can I help people solve?”

Here are a few examples:

  • If you are good at organizing, help busy people create productivity systems.
  • If you are good at writing, offer blog posts, email sequences, or resumes.
  • If you are good at teaching, create lesson notes, study guides, or digital courses.
  • If you are good at cooking, create meal planners, recipe ebooks, or grocery lists.
  • If you are good at speaking, offer script writing, presentation coaching, or podcast prep.

AI makes it easier to turn those ideas into polished deliverables. You do not need to start with something huge. One useful solution is enough.

Step 3: Use AI to Save Time and Improve Quality

AI is most powerful when it handles the repetitive parts of the work so you can focus on the human parts: judgment, creativity, and personality.

For example, you can use AI to:

  • Brainstorm side hustle ideas
  • Create outlines for ebooks, guides, and courses
  • Draft social media captions and promotional emails
  • Generate content variations for different audiences
  • Edit grammar, tone, and structure
  • Summarize research or customer feedback
  • Build templates and systems you can reuse

The goal is not to sound robotic. The goal is to move faster while still sounding like you.

Step 4: Turn Your Skill Into a Simple Offer

Once you know your skill and the problem it solves, create one simple offer. Keep it easy to understand.

Here are some examples of beginner-friendly offers:

  • A resume rewrite service
  • A custom meal plan
  • A social media content pack
  • A printable planner or checklist
  • An ebook on a topic you know well
  • A mini-course or workshop
  • A done-for-you email template bundle
  • A coaching session or feedback call

If people can understand what you do in one sentence, you are on the right track.

Examples of Skills You Can Turn Into Income

Here are a few practical examples of how everyday skills can become AI-powered side hustles:

  • Writing: Use AI to help draft blog posts, newsletters, product descriptions, or ebooks.
  • Teaching: Turn your knowledge into study guides, lesson plans, worksheets, or online classes.
  • Design: Use AI to brainstorm visuals, create content layouts, and speed up client work.
  • Coaching: Use AI to organize session notes, create action plans, and develop client resources.
  • Administration: Offer systems, templates, calendars, and workflow setup for busy professionals.
  • Customer service: Create response templates, FAQ documents, and communication scripts for small businesses.

What to Avoid When Starting

When people first use AI, they often make one of three mistakes. They either try to do too much, depend on AI too much, or never actually publish anything.

Avoid these traps:

  • Trying to build ten offers at once
  • Copying AI output without adding your own voice
  • Waiting until everything is perfect
  • Choosing a skill you don’t enjoy just because it seems profitable
  • Ignoring what your audience actually needs

Start small. Test quickly. Improve as you go.

A Simple 7-Day Plan to Get Started

If you want to begin this week, here is a simple plan:

  1. Day 1: List your top 5 skills and the problems they solve.
  2. Day 2: Pick one skill and one audience.
  3. Day 3: Use AI to brainstorm 3 possible offers.
  4. Day 4: Choose the easiest offer to create first.
  5. Day 5: Draft your offer, outline, or service package with AI.
  6. Day 6: Improve it with your own examples, style, and experience.
  7. Day 7: Share it with friends, social media, or a small audience and ask for feedback.

That is enough to move from idea to action.

Frequently Asked Questions

Do I need to be an AI expert to start?

No. You only need to know how to use AI as a helper. Your existing skill is the main asset, and AI simply helps you work faster and create better outputs.

What if I don’t feel skilled enough?

Most people start by solving a small problem they already understand. If others ask you for help with it, that is often enough to begin.

What kinds of side hustles work best with AI?

The best ones are simple, repeatable, and based on a skill you already have. Writing, teaching, organizing, design, coaching, and admin support are all good starting points.

Can I make money with just one skill?

Yes. One clear skill can become a service, a digital product, or a content-based offer. You do not need to offer everything at once.

How do I avoid sounding like AI wrote everything?

Use AI for structure, brainstorming, and editing, then add your own examples, opinions, tone, and experience. That is what makes the work feel real and trustworthy.
